Transaction ff2111338175d4e5736c81a4f26e6b4fc9dfb0b37db3804eadf5ecc56e18a01d
1 Input
2 Outputs
- ff2111338175d4e5736c81a4f26e6b4fc9dfb0b37db3804eadf5ecc56e18a01d:0
- ff2111338175d4e5736c81a4f26e6b4fc9dfb0b37db3804eadf5ecc56e18a01d:1
value 428586
address 1HtH2Dx3yu7uVsxxrWV6KBcpG7BeuFgDKz
value 1686118
address 3NfnqKeU7xGNECWNUe9Quxy6xQEKGFnBmL